What is an embedded machine learning?

An Embedded Machine Learning job involves developing and optimizing machine learning models to run efficiently on resource-constrained devices like microcontrollers, edge devices, and IoT hardware. Professionals in this role work on model compression, low-power inference, and real-time processing, ensuring AI capabilities can function without relying on cloud computing. Responsibilities often include data preprocessing, feature extraction, model training, and deployment on embedded systems using frameworks like TensorFlow Lite or Edge Impulse.

What are some common challenges faced by professionals working in embedded machine learning roles?

Professionals in embedded machine learning roles often face the challenge of optimizing machine learning models to run efficiently on resource-constrained hardware, such as microcontrollers or edge devices with limited memory and processing power. Balancing model accuracy, inference speed, and energy consumption can require creative problem-solving and deep knowledge of both hardware and software. Additionally, collaboration with hardware engineers, data scientists, and software developers is key, as projects typically require cross-functional teamwork to meet performance and deployment goals. Staying current with rapidly evolving tools and best practices is also important in this dynamic field.

Meet the team:
In the Performance team, we integrate and optimize software solutions from prototypes to the final product. Our main driver is to make the vehicle react as fast and deterministically as possible to its environment. We are involved in multiple cross-functional projects with stakeholders across the whole company: monitoring performance, optimizing foundation libraries, scheduling accelerators intelligently, and generally squeezing more out of the on-vehicle compute resources.
As part of the Intelligent Systems organization, we are particularly interested in converting photons into a view of the world, primarily via computer vision and machine learning. But our scope is not limited to perception, and influences the whole autonomy stack. We take pride in having a direct impact on the product quality and viability.
